Biography
Linda Cornet was born on January 26, 1962 in the city of Leiden in the province of South Holland . Engaged in rowing in Harlem at the local club Het Spaarne.
She made her rowing debut in the international arena in the 1980 season when she joined the Dutch national team and performed at the junior world championship in Hasevinkel, where she finished fifth in the standings of the oar steering fours.
In 1983, she started in two-wheel-drive deuces at the adult world championship in Duisburg , managed to qualify here only for the consolation final B and was located in the final protocol of the competitions on the eighth line.
She achieved the greatest success in her sports career in 1984 when, as part of the Netherlands rowing team, she was awarded the right to defend the country's honor at the Summer Olympic Games in Los Angeles . The crew, which also included the rowers, Gret Hellemans , Nicolette Hellemans , Marike van Drogenbrook , Harrit van Ettekoven , Catalin Nelissen , Anne-Marie Quist , Villon Vandrager and helmsman Marty Laureisen , in the finals of the eights came to the finish line of the third crew and behind Romania - thereby won the bronze Olympic medal. She also started in Los Angeles in two-wheelless deuces, but here she could not get into the number of winners - she was fourth at the finish.
After the Los Angeles Olympics, Cornet no longer showed any significant results in rowing at the international level.
